Local Nursery Scene in Albuquerque

Albuquerque gardeners manage a unique high-desert environment. With fourteen distinct nurseries and garden centers, the city provides a robust infrastructure for both novice growers and commercial landscapers. Success here requires choosing flora adapted to USDA hardiness zones 7 and 8, where extreme temperature fluctuations and limited rainfall define the growing season. Most successful local operations emphasize drought-tolerant xeriscaping, native plants that support local pollinators, and soil amendments that can turn alkaline clay into nutrient-rich growing mediums.

Buying Guide for NM Gardeners

  • Climate Acclimation: Prioritize plants sourced from local nurseries that grow their inventory on-site. Plants raised in high-desert conditions are hardened off to withstand Albuquerque's intense UV rays and dry winds.
  • Soil Prep: New Mexico soil is often heavy clay with high alkalinity. Always budget for organic amendments like compost or pine bark to improve drainage and pH levels before planting.
  • Watering Strategy: Native species like Penstemon, Apache Plume, and Desert Willow require significantly less water once established. Focus on drip irrigation systems to minimize evaporation losses.
  • Inspection: Check leaves for spider mites and scale, which thrive in dry, hot conditions. Look for robust root structures that aren't pot-bound; a healthy start in the nursery pot prevents transplant shock in the garden.
  • Seasonal Timing: Respect the frost dates. While spring fever hits in April, nights can still drop significantly. Utilize professional advice from local nurseries to determine the safest windows for putting out tender annuals.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Why is it better to buy from a local nursery than a big-box store?

A: Local nurseries in Albuquerque specialize in plants that are already acclimated to the high-desert climate. Big-box retailers often ship inventory from different hardiness zones, which can result in transplant shock or failure. Local nurseries provide expert advice on regional soil pH, water requirements, and specific planting windows that are unique to the Albuquerque area.

Q: What are the benefits of using native plants in an Albuquerque landscape?

A: Native plants, such as those found at Osuna Nursery, are naturally adapted to local rainfall patterns and heat. They require less supplemental water, survive with minimal fertilizers, and provide essential habitat for local pollinators, which is critical for maintaining biodiversity in the high-desert environment.

Q: What should I look for when amending New Mexico soil?

A: New Mexico soil is typically alkaline clay that drains poorly. You should incorporate high-quality organic matter, such as compost or aged manure, to break up heavy clay and improve aeration. Nurseries like Rehm's can provide specific organic amendments to help balance your soil's pH for better nutrient uptake.

Q: What is the difference between a retail garden center and a wholesale nursery?

A: A retail garden center is designed for homeowners and hobbyists, offering smaller quantities, expert advice, and integrated decor. A wholesale nursery, like Plant World, typically serves contractors and commercial landscapers, focusing on bulk quantities and specimen-sized plants. However, many wholesale facilities offer 'Garden Club' programs that allow retail customers access to their catalog.

Q: When is the best time to plant in Albuquerque?

A: The ideal planting time for trees, shrubs, and perennials is during the cooler months of fall or early spring. This allows the root systems to establish before the intense summer heat sets in. For annuals and vegetables, mid-April to May is usually the safest window, but always monitor local frost forecasts before putting out delicate varieties.
